Background
Color printing refers to a technique of printing on the same page in different colors in different steps to achieve a color picture effect, and transferring ink to the surface of paper, fabric, leather and other materials by processes of plate making, inking, pressurizing and the like, so as to copy the content of the original in batches. After the paper is color-printed, the paper is cut by the paper cutter to cut the redundant part of the paper.
However, after the cutting blade of the existing paper cutting machine is repeatedly cut, paper scraps may adhere to the cutting edge, which causes the cut paper to have a long and short top and bottom or a left and right skew phenomenon, thereby reducing the aesthetic property of the paper, seriously cutting the color-printed part, and being not beneficial to improving the use efficiency of the paper cutting machine.
